Fannie Mae Reverse Mortgage Market Share Falls 85% from 2009
May 11, 2010Fannie Mae (NYSE:FNM) saw its market share of reverse mortgage acquisitions fall from roughly 90% during the first quarter of 2009 to approximately 5% in the first quarter of 2010 according to its latest filing from the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).
